Viewpoint: There is insufficient participation of retail investors in the current market, and retail investors are becoming more and more sophisticated

BlockBeats news, October 1, CoinDesk senior analyst James Van Straten said that in the current cycle, there may not be so many retail investors, and they are becoming more sophisticated.


James said that retail investors were an important factor in the last round of cryptocurrency bull market, and they helped push up the prices and market enthusiasm of digital assets. Many people entered the crypto market for the first time during the COVID lockdown from 2021 to 2022.


This round of bull market cycle began in mid-2023 and is more dominated by institutions. Today, the main topic revolves around ETFs and the slow but steady adoption of TradFi. So far, retail investors have not returned in the same numbers. (Meme coins are an exception)
